FILM DESCRIPTION:
Based on the novel by Hubert Selby Jr., this gritty drama concerns four people trapped by their addictions. Harry (Jared Leto), and his best friend Tyrone (Marlon Wayans) are impoverished heroin addicts living in Coney Island, NY, while Harry's girlfriend Marion (Jennifer Connelly) is a fellow addict trying to distance herself from her wealthy father. Harry dreams of scoring a pound of smack, from which he could make enough money to open a clothing boutique with Marion, but so far he and his friends can barely scrape by supporting their own habits. Meanwhile, Harry's mother Sara (Ellen Burstyn), who spends her days watching television, is told she has the opportunity to appear on her favorite game show; wanting to lose enough weight to fit into her favorite red dress, she visits a sleazy doctor who gives her a prescription for amphetamines. Soon Sara has a drug habit of her own that is spiraling out of control. Requiem for a Dream was directed by Darren Aronofsky, who also co-wrote the screenplay with Selby; it was Aronofsky's second feature, following his acclaimed independent film Pi.

I'm not sure what you mean by stronger. If you mean that someone is more likely to become addicted to heroin than alcohol, there's not actually a good empirical, statistical way to measure likelihood of addiction. Even though we hear stories in the media and health ed class of nightmare drug addicts, the reality of illicit substance use is far more complex. For example, heroin was used by millions of soldiers in the vietnam war, and there was a fear that these soldiers would become serious opiate addicts when they returned home, in truth only a percentage of veterans continued heroin use while most did not. In fact, when looking at heroin vs. alcohol in terms of which one someone is more likely to be addicted to, alcohol wins. Alcohol is readily available to be purchased legally, while Heroin involves dealing with the black market which is much more difficult and dangerous and subject to large flucctuations in availability. Because of legality, most people with addiction issues in America are addicted to alcohol more than any other subsance.
